Eggplant with Balado sambal
A very simple recipe for lunch, easy to make and very delicious, perfect for breakfast, lunch or dinner, serve it with warm rice and you ready to go!
#eggplant #sambal #indonesia
Cooking Instructions
- 1
Cut the eggplant lengthwise, sear it with a little bit of oil until it's a bit tender. Set aside
- 2
While the eggplant is cooking, in a food processor add chilies, garlic, shallots, and tomato. Blitz few times, until you got a rough chop consistency.
- 3
Pre-heat pan, add oil, chili mixture, and keffir lime leaves to the pan, sauté few minutes until it fragrant.
- 4
Once it's fragrant, add mushroom powder, then do a taste check and then add cooked eggplant, cook it for 10 minutes in medium low heat.
- 5
Once it's done, serve it with warm rice!
- 6
Tip : If you want the sambal to be a little saucy, you can add water to the sambal before you add the eggplant.

Sour Eggplant Hot Sauce (SAMBAL TERONG ASAM) Sour Eggplant Hot Sauce (SAMBAL TERONG ASAM)
Riau has a variety of typical dishes, one of which is the SAMBAL TONGAK ASAM or Sambal Terong Asam. The cuisine is usually served with grilled shrimp, and the main ingredient is sour eggplant (Solaum ferox Linn) which can be made into a sauce in a fresh state or grilled first. Sambal Terong Asam is the typical dish of Riau which is always the "accessories" dish for the Malays in Riau, especially the Malay Archipelago and the Malay East coast of Sumatra.This cuisine is also found in Borneo with the same ingredients that is sour eggplant in the Dayak Ngaju language called Rimbang. But for the ingredients used in the sour eggplant sauce, it is of a kind that is small or small fruiting - which has a sharper taste and aroma. Generally served with smoked fish.Sour eggplant growing place of origin is unknown, there are planted ones and there some also growing in the wild. It is spread from India to the territory of Papua New Guinea, including all countries around Southeast Asia.Eggplant fruit acid contains water, carbohydrates, protein, fat, fiber, minerals and vitamins.
